Title :
UML Specification of e-Consent Requirements in a Health Care System

Abstract :
Access control requirements have become an important part in any secure system. Specification of these requirements at early steps of the software life cycle can provide stakeholders rapid feedback and protect the system in a best possible way. In this paper, we utilize UML model to specify and visualize the access control policies in a health application domain. We first identify various parts necessary to specify patient record protection requirements through e-consent, and then propose UML models to demonstrate these requirements.
